Vettel Is Better Than Senna, Says Ecclestone

On his way to winning his fourth Formula One world championship, German driver Sebastian Vettel is obviously one of the best drivers of the series. But to some, the 26-year-old is more than that.
For instance, Red Bull Racing boss Christian Horner thinks the German is on par with racing legends such as Juan Manual Fangio, Jim Clark and Ayrton Senna. “For me, he is now on par with Juan Manuel Fangio, Jim Clark, Jackie Stewart, Ayrton Senna, Alain Prost and Michael Schumacher,” said Horner, quoted by Spox.

But Formula One chief Bernie Ecclestone takes it even further, claiming that Sebastian Vettel is even better than Ayrton Senna, a driver that tops most performance and popularity-based F1 hierarchies. “People don’t known how many titles Senna would have won, but Vettel is probably the best we’ve had.”

A bit ridiculous of the two to compare a 21st century driver to the likes of Fangio or Jimmy Clark, but we’ve seen this before in the Michael Schumacher era... You can share your opinions with us via the comment box below.
